The Blue Beetle #7
Blue Beetle #7 from November 2006 promises a wild ride with its tagline "How I Survived My Infinite Crisis," setting up a story that ties Jaime Reyes directly into DC's universe-shaking event. Duncan Rouleau's cover captures the scarab-armored Blue Beetle tumbling head-over-heels through a crumbling, circular environment — debris scattering all around — while two figures, a green-costumed character and a blonde woman, look on from the rim above. Writers John Rogers and artist Cully Hamner bring their energetic storytelling to "Brother's Keeper," and this issue looks like a genuinely fun piece of that post-Infinite Crisis DC landscape.
